When it comes to high-performance materials, ETFE Teflon is one that stands out for its unique properties and wide range of applications Also known as ethylene tetrafluoroethylene, ETFE Teflon is a fluoropolymer that offers exceptional resistance to chemicals, heat, and weathering This makes it a versatile choice for a variety of industries, from construction to pharmaceuticals to aerospace.
One of the key characteristics of ETFE Teflon is its high transparency With a light transmission of up to 95%, ETFE Teflon is often used in architectural projects to create stunning facades and roofs that allow natural light to flood interior spaces Its lightweight nature also makes it a popular choice for large-span structures, as it can be used to create durable and aesthetically pleasing designs.
In addition to its transparency, ETFE Teflon is also known for its exceptional strength and durability It has a high tensile strength, making it an ideal material for applications that require resistance to impact and abrasion ETFE Teflon is also resistant to UV radiation, which helps it maintain its physical properties over time, even when exposed to harsh weather conditions.
Another advantage of ETFE Teflon is its chemical resistance It is inert to most chemicals, making it a safe choice for use in environments where exposure to corrosive substances is a concern This property also makes ETFE Teflon easy to clean and maintain, as it does not react with most cleaning agents or solvents.
ETFE Teflon is also known for its thermal stability It has a high melting point and can withstand temperatures ranging from -200°C to 150°C, making it suitable for use in both extreme cold and hot environments etfe teflon. This property makes ETFE Teflon a reliable choice for applications where temperature fluctuations are a concern, such as in aerospace components or automotive parts.
Due to its versatile properties, ETFE Teflon is used in a wide range of industries In the construction industry, it is often used in the form of films, sheets, or panels to create energy-efficient building envelopes ETFE Teflon is lightweight and easy to install, making it a cost-effective choice for projects that require large-scale coverage, such as stadiums, airports, and shopping malls.
In the pharmaceutical industry, ETFE Teflon is used to create containers and tubing that are chemically inert and resistant to contamination Its high purity and transparency make it an ideal material for storing and transporting sensitive drugs and chemicals without the risk of leaching or degradation.
In the aerospace industry, ETFE Teflon is used in a variety of applications, including wiring insulation, aircraft components, and thermal protection systems Its lightweight nature and resistance to high temperatures make it a valuable material for building aircraft that are fuel-efficient and durable.
In the automotive industry, ETFE Teflon is used to create high-performance seals, gaskets, and hoses that can withstand extreme temperatures and corrosive fluids Its flexibility and durability make it a reliable choice for applications that require precise engineering and tight tolerances.
